Enhancing Nab-Paclitaxel Delivery Using Microbubble-Assisted Ultrasound in a Pancreatic Cancer Model

Abstract: The combination of microbubbles and ultrasound is an emerging method for non-invasive and targeted enhancement of anticancer drugs uptake. This method showed to increase local drug extravasation in tumor tissue while reducing the systemic adverse effects in various tumor models. The present study aims into evaluating the therapeutic efficacy of this approach both in-vitro and in-vivo for Nab-paclitaxel delivery in a pancreatic tumor model. “…The study showed that the ultrasound microbubbles treatment group presented significant tumor growth inhibition (67). In addition, the use of nab-paclitaxel combined with ultrasound microbubbles significantly inhibited the activity of PDAC tumor cells in vitro and reduced the tumor volume in a subcutaneous PDAC mouse model (68). Furthermore, a clinical trial evaluated the efficacy of focused ultrasound combined with microbubble delivery of gemcitabine in PDAC patients.…”

“…PTX toxicity arises not only from the drug itself but also from the high concentration of the Cremophor EL vehicle, which is required to solubilize the poorly aqueous PTX into an injectable solution. The most common toxicities associated with Cremophor EL include acute hypersensitivity reactions, which are recognizable as flushing, rash, dyspnea and tachycardia (Bhatt et al, 2019; Bressand et al, 2019).…”
